JERUSALEM — Palestinian Islamic Jihad terrorists left two bags filled with explosives in a suburb outside Jerusalem, and attempted several times to infiltrate the city to collect the explosives and carry out a large-scale suicide bombing, security sources told WND.
The revelation follows recent comments by Palestinian Authority President Mahmoud Abbas that the era of suicide bombings is over.
Israeli forces recently arrested an Islamic Jihad terrorist responsible for orchestrating a suicide attack that killed five Israelis outside a Tel Aviv nightclub Feb. 25. Upon interrogation, the operative detailed a pending suicide operation in Jerusalem to be carried out by terrorists from the central West Bank, security sources said.
The information led to the arrests two weeks ago of five Islamic Jihad members, including Iyyad Ahmad Hussein Fawajra, 27, a resident of Bethlehem who tried to lead two potential suicide bombers to Ramot, a Jerusalem neighborhood, to carry out a suicide bombing on a bus or at a coffee shop.
